Davao City – In line with its Mother’s Day campaign, Maxim Rides & Food Delivery organized a donation activity at SOS Children’s Village Davao on May 7, 2026, distributing hygiene and toiletry kits.
SOS Children’s Village Davao is a private, non-political, non-denominational organization that provides long-term, family-based care and education to children in need. Children who have lost parental care are raised in a family-like environment alongside an SOS mother, their siblings, and other children. They receive holistic care and support until they are ready to live independently.
An SOS mother lives with the children and attends to their daily needs while respecting each child’s culture, family background, and personal story. Through her constant presence and guidance, she provides the care and emotional support the children need as they grow.
The outreach benefited 79 children by providing essential personal care and hygiene supplies. A team composed of two staff members and five driver-partners facilitated the delivery of the donations.
